Převod DWF do DOC pomocí GroupDocs.Conversion pro .NET: Podrobný návod

Zavedení

V projektech vyžadujících transformaci složitých CAD výkresů z formátu Design Web Format (DWF) do dokumentů Word může být ruční konverze těžkopádná. GroupDocs.Conversion pro .NET zjednodušuje tento proces tím, že umožňuje bezproblémové převody z DWF do DOC.

Tento tutoriál vás provede používáním nástroje GroupDocs.Conversion pro .NET k převodu souborů DWF do dokumentů Wordu pomocí jazyka C#. Naučíte se, jak nastavit prostředí a provést převod, a vybavíte se tak efektivními dovednostmi v oblasti správy dokumentů.

Co se naučíte:

  • Nastavení GroupDocs.Conversion pro .NET
  • Načítání souborů DWF pro převod
  • Konfigurace možností převodu pro formát DOC
  • Ukládání a správa převedených dokumentů

Začněme tím, že si probereme předpoklady pro hladký start!

Předpoklady

Než budete pokračovat, ujistěte se, že máte:

Požadované knihovny, verze a závislosti:

  • GroupDocs.Conversion pro .NETUjistěte se, že je nainstalována verze 25.3.0 nebo novější.

Požadavky na nastavení prostředí:

  • Kompatibilní vývojové prostředí .NET (např. Visual Studio)
  • Základní znalost programování v C#

Nastavení GroupDocs.Conversion pro .NET

Nainstalujte knihovnu GroupDocs.Conversion pomocí jedné z těchto metod:

Konzola Správce balíčků NuGet:

Install-Package GroupDocs.Conversion -Version 25.3.0

Rozhraní příkazového řádku .NET:

dotnet add package GroupDocs.Conversion --version 25.3.0

Získání licence

GroupDocs nabízí bezplatnou zkušební verzi pro prozkoumání svých možností s možností dočasných nebo plných licencí.

  1. Bezplatná zkušební verze: Začněte zde.
  2. Dočasná licenceŽádost na Dočasná licence GroupDocs.
  3. Zakoupit licenciPro kompletní funkce zakupte od Nákup GroupDocs.

Základní inicializace a nastavení

Inicializujte knihovnu GroupDocs.Conversion ve vaší aplikaci C# pomocí:

using System;
using GroupDocs.Conversion;

namespace DwfToDocConversion
{
    class Program
    {
        static void Main(string[] args)
        {
            string documentDirectory = @"YOUR_DOCUMENT_DIRECTORY";
            string sampleDwfPath = Path.Combine(documentDirectory, "sample.dwf");

            // Inicializujte převodník zdrojovým souborem DWF
            using (var converter = new Converter(sampleDwfPath))
            {
                Console.WriteLine("Converter initialized successfully.");
            }
        }
    }
}

Průvodce implementací

Načíst zdrojový soubor DWF

Přehled: Začněte načtením zdrojového souboru DWF pomocí GroupDocs.Conversion a připravte objekt převodníku pro další operace.

Krok 1: Definování cest k dokumentům

string documentDirectory = @"YOUR_DOCUMENT_DIRECTORY";
string sampleDwfPath = Path.Combine(documentDirectory, "sample.dwf");
  • Proč? Zajišťuje správné nastavení cesty k souboru pro načtení souboru DWF.

Krok 2: Inicializace objektu Converter

using (var converter = new Converter(sampleDwfPath))
{
    // Objekt převodníku je připraven pro operace převodu dokumentů.
}
  • Co to dělá: Načte soubor DWF a připraví převodník pro úlohy převodu.

Konfigurace možností převodu textového editoru

Přehled: Dále nastavte možnosti pro převod souboru DWF do formátu DOC pomocí nastavení GroupDocs.Conversion.

Krok 1: Nastavení výstupního adresáře

string outputDirectory = @"YOUR_OUTPUT_DIRECTORY";
  • Proč? Určuje, kam bude převedený dokument uložen.

Krok 2: Vytvořte možnosti konverze

using GroupDocs.Conversion.Options.Convert;

WordProcessingConvertOptions options = new WordProcessingConvertOptions
{
    Format = FileTypes.WordProcessingFileType.Doc // Zadejte DOC jako cílový formát
};
  • Proč? Konfiguruje proces převodu pro výstup souboru DOC.

Uložit převedený soubor DOC

Přehled: Nakonec uložte převedený soubor DOC pomocí nakonfigurovaných možností.

Krok 1: Definování výstupní cesty

string outputFile = Path.Combine(outputDirectory, "dwf-converted-to.doc");
  • Proč? Určuje, kam a pod jakým názvem se má soubor DOC uložit.

Krok 2: Proveďte konverzi a uložte ji

using (var converter = new Converter(sampleDwfPath))
{
    // Převeďte a uložte dokument do formátu DOC
    converter.Convert(outputFile, options);
}
  • Co to dělá: Převede soubor DWF do formátu DOC a uloží jej do zvoleného adresáře.

Tipy pro řešení problémů

  • Ujistěte se, že jsou cesty správně definovány, abyste se vyhnuli FileNotFoundException.
  • Ověřte potřebná oprávnění k výstupnímu adresáři.
  • Pokud se při převodu vyskytnou chyby, zkontrolujte, zda zdrojový soubor DWF není poškozen.

Praktické aplikace

GroupDocs.Conversion pro .NET lze použít v různých scénářích:

  1. Recenze architektonického designuPřevod CAD výkresů do upravitelných formátů DOC pro spolupráci a vytváření anotací.
  2. Automatizované generování dokumentaceZjednodušte tvorbu dokumentace z návrhových souborů v rámci podnikových systémů.
  3. Projekty migrace datUsnadňuje konverzi formátů během upgradu systému nebo migrace dat.

Úvahy o výkonu

Pro optimální výkon:

  • Optimalizace využití zdrojůEfektivní správa paměti, zejména u velkých dokumentů.
  • Nejlepší postupyVyužívejte asynchronní operace a elegantně zpracovávejte výjimky.

Závěr

Nyní jste se naučili, jak převádět soubory DWF do formátu DOC pomocí nástroje GroupDocs.Conversion pro .NET. Tato funkce vylepšuje pracovní postupy správy dokumentů napříč odvětvími.

Další kroky:

  • Prozkoumejte další formáty souborů podporované nástrojem GroupDocs.Conversion.
  • Prozkoumejte další funkce a možnosti přizpůsobení v knihovně.

Jste připraveni začít s převodem dokumentů? Implementujte toto řešení ve svých projektech ještě dnes!

Sekce Často kladených otázek

  1. Mohu převést více souborů DWF najednou?

    • Ano, rozšířit tuto implementaci pro dávkové konverze pomocí smyček nebo paralelního zpracování.
  2. Jaké formáty kromě DOC podporuje GroupDocs.Conversion?

    • Podporuje mnoho formátů dokumentů včetně PDF, PPTX, XLSX a dalších.
  3. Jsou s používáním GroupDocs.Conversion pro .NET spojeny nějaké náklady?

    • K dispozici je bezplatná zkušební verze; licenční poplatky se účtují v závislosti na potřebách používání nad rámec této licence.
  4. Jak mám řešit chyby v konverzi?

    • Pro efektivní správu výjimek implementujte bloky try-catch kolem logiky konverze.
  5. Lze toto řešení integrovat do stávajících .NET aplikací?

    • Rozhodně! GroupDocs.Conversion se snadno integruje s jakoukoli architekturou .NET aplikací.

Zdroje